    Product Description

    Iromycin A is a bacterial pyridone metabolite that inhibits nitric oxide synthase (NOS) activity, with selectivity for NOS III (endothelial NOS) over NOS I (neuronal NOS).1,2 Iromycin metabolites and derivatives block NADH oxidation in beef heart submitochondrial particles (IC50 = 0.461 µM for iromycin A).3
